Grades K-5 Themes
June 7: Boom, Pop, Splat!
June 14: DIY Circuits
Explore electricity and circuits! Investigate how electrons move. Master the basics of building working circuits while also challenging your creativity as you design new circuitry projects! Hobby motors, buzzers, LEDs, and switches are just some of the components campers will be using as they engineer their circuit creations.

August 16: Super STEM
This camp is jam packed with activities from all areas of STEM. This summer, we will be featuring camper favorites such as discovering what yeast likes to eat, engineering the best zipline, designing marble roller coasters, and creating chemical reactions! Each SuperSTEM Camp will have different activities, sign up for them both!
